Perez Hilton: Chatting With…Joey McIntyre (Part 2) (VIDEO)

  

Now, in Part 2 of our EXCLUSIVE interview, Joey Mac shares some very exciting news… The New Kids On The Block are recording an ALL NEW album!!

Perez: So after the [Mix Tape] Festival are the boys taking a break? Is NKOTB going on a cruise?
Joey McIntyre: That’s in May. You’ve got to check that out man. It’s not even – you’ve seen some of the buzz.
Perez: Do you spend the whole time on the cruise?
Joey McIntyre: Yes. It’s one big family! It’s hard to explain, but there is so much joy on the boat. People say ‘What do you hide? How do you get around?’ No, it’s like these fans have, you know, been with us for so long that it’s like [they’re our] family. And I’m at the point where yeah, if I need five minutes I’m going to take it. You know what I mean? But we give 150 percent because these are the greatest fans in the world, and it’s a blast. It’s a four day cruise and it’s nuts. I know [what it sounds like].
Perez: NO! I think it’s cool!
Joey McIntyre: At first we would joke about it. But that first time we got on the lido deck it was like Spring Break. It was just crazy, and it was ON for four days. You have to come one of these days. We’ll helicopter you in.
Perez: These females [on the cruise] are a little bit older. They still like to get wild?
Joey McIntyre: DUDE! First of all, they look great. They get ready for this cruise!
Perez: I’m not saying that they don’t look great! [I’m saying] they’re probably in their forties….
Joey McIntyre: Not all of them. Not all of them.
Perez: Late thirties…
Joey McIntyre: Yeah, but they have so much fun. It’s a getaway. It’s defiantly NOT a girls night out, it’s a girls weekend out. Where they just want to have a great time. We pull out all the stops, surprises, we have theme nights and singing.
Perez: You perform every night?
Joey McIntyre: Not every night. There is a group concert, but then I do a solo show, Jordan [Knight] does a solo show, Donnie [Wahlberg] does a special… you have to be there to really believe it show.

Perez: Is there a plan? Like, [do you say] ‘Okay, we have been reunited for a long time.’ Since 2008 was it?
Joey McIntyre: Yeah.
Perez: [You ask yourselves] Do we want to do it five years and then take a few years off? Is there a plan?
Joey McIntyre: Well, the plan is to have fun, number one. Cause if we don’t have fun, it’s gonna show up [on stage] and we want to make it fresh and exciting. In 2008, 2009 we came back on our own. We did some cool things in between that, and then [going on tour with] The Backsteet Boys is a whole other thing — it was great. Hopefully we can keep it fresh. We’re starting to actually make some more music because we’re happy with the record we made in 2008, so we’re getting back to the studio.

Step by step: The childhood home of the Knight brothers

It's not listed in any tourist guide, but NKOTB fans flock to the house where the Knight brothers grew up By Johnny Diaz Globe Staff / November 15, 2008 When Kari Lusso and her trio of girlfriends flew from Seattle to Boston for the New Kids on the Block concert, they had to make a quick detour. On a rainy Saturday night, the friends drove their rental car to 10 Melville Ave. As they stood in front of the Victorian house, they shrieked and giggled like little girls. The commotion? They were at the former home of the band's brothers Jonathan and Jordan Knight. When they rang the bell, they got a quick tour. "It was going from 31 to 13," Lusso said.
